Top Ranking Student – Maths Physics Chemistry

The program must accept the marks scored by N students in Maths, Physics and Chemistry and print the name of the single top ranking student.
– In case two students have scored same total marks, consider Maths marks. The student who has scored higher in Maths is the top ranking student.
– In case two students have scored same total marks and have Maths marks equal, consider Physics marks.
– In case two students have scored same total marks and have Maths and Physics marks equal, consider Chemistry marks.

Input Format: The first line contains N. N lines follow with each line containing Name and marks in Maths, Physics, Chemistry of a specific student (the values are separated by a space).

Output Format: The first line contains the name of the top ranking student.

Boundary Conditions: 1 <= N <= 20

Example Input/Output 1:

Input:
3
Arundathi 100 90 85
Bhuvana 100 95 80
Chandan 100 95 78

Output:
Bhuvana

num=int(input())
li=[]
for ele in range(num):
    name,maths,physics,chemistry=map(str,input().split())
    total=int(maths)+int(physics)+int(chemistry)
    li.append([total,int(maths),int(physics),int(chemistry),name])
li.sort(reverse=True)
print(li[0][-1])
